Stuart, Florida is a charming coastal town located in Martin County, along the eastern coast of the state. The town is known for its laid-back atmosphere, beautiful beaches, and rich history, making it a popular destination for both tourists and residents alike.

Stuart is often referred to as the “Sailfish Capital of the World,” and for good reason. The town is a haven for anglers and boaters, offering some of the best fishing and boating opportunities in the state. With its proximity to the Atlantic Ocean and the St. Lucie River, Stuart provides ample opportunities for water-based activities such as deep-sea fishing, sailing, kayaking, and paddleboarding.

In addition to its water-based activities, Stuart also boasts a vibrant downtown area filled with quaint shops, art galleries, and restaurants. The downtown area is a hub of activity, with events and festivals happening regularly. The weekly Stuart Green Market is a popular event that brings together local vendors and artisans, offering a wide variety of fresh produce, handmade crafts, and delicious food.

Stuart is also rich in history, with several historical landmarks and attractions to explore. The town’s historic downtown area is home to many well-preserved buildings that date back to the early 20th century. The Stuart Heritage Museum provides a glimpse into the town’s past, with exhibits showcasing the history of the local community and its impact on the region.

For nature enthusiasts, Stuart offers a range of outdoor activities, including hiking, bird-watching, and wildlife photography. The nearby Jonathan Dickinson State Park is a popular destination for outdoor recreation, featuring over 13,000 acres of natural beauty, including hiking trails, picnic areas, and camping facilities.
